What is a senior controls engineer?

Senior Controls Engineers are experienced professionals who design, develop, and implement control systems for manufacturing processes, machinery, or automation equipment. They are responsible for programming controllers (such as PLCs), troubleshooting control system issues, and ensuring optimal system performance and safety. Senior Controls Engineers often lead project teams, mentor junior engineers, and collaborate with other departments to integrate new technologies. Their expertise is crucial for streamlining production, reducing downtime, and maintaining compliance with industry standards.

What are the typical responsibilities of a senior controls engineer in a manufacturing environment?

As a Senior Controls Engineer in a manufacturing setting, you can expect to lead the design, programming, and troubleshooting of automation systems such as PLCs, HMIs, and SCADA. Your responsibilities often include overseeing control system upgrades, optimizing equipment for efficiency, and ensuring compliance with safety standards. You will regularly collaborate with cross-functional teams—including maintenance, production, and IT—to implement solutions and support continuous improvement initiatives. Managing complex projects and mentoring junior engineers are also common aspects of the role.

What are the key skills and qualifications needed to thrive as a senior controls engineer?

To thrive as a Senior Controls Engineer, you need a strong background in electrical engineering, automation, and control systems, often supported by a relevant bachelor's degree and several years of experience in industrial automation. Expertise in PLC programming, SCADA systems, HMI development, and knowledge of industry standards and certifications like ISA or PE are typically required. Strong analytical thinking, project management, and excellent communication skills help distinguish top performers in this role. These competencies ensure the effective design, implementation, and troubleshooting of complex control systems, which are critical for operational safety, efficiency, and project success.

What is the difference between Senior Controls Engineer vs Controls Engineer?

AspectSenior Controls EngineerControls Engineer
Required CredentialsBachelor's degree in engineering, experience, possibly certifications like Certified Control Systems Technician (CCST)Bachelor's degree in engineering or related field, entry to mid-level experience
Work EnvironmentDesign, development, troubleshooting, project leadership in industrial or manufacturing settingsImplementing control systems, programming, testing, and maintenance in similar environments
Employer & Industry UsageManufacturing, automation, process control companiesSimilar industries, often as entry to mid-level roles within the same sectors

The main difference is experience level and responsibility. Senior Controls Engineers typically lead projects, design complex systems, and mentor junior staff, while Controls Engineers focus on implementing and maintaining control systems. Both roles require similar credentials and work in comparable environments, but the senior role involves more leadership and advanced technical skills.

Senior DevOps AI Platform Engineer
Are you ready to take your career to the next level with a rapidly growing global company? As a Senior DevOps Platform Engineer, you will establish and scale the enterprise DevOps operating model for GXO's Agentic AI Platform. This role is responsible for building secure, automated, and scalable cloud platform capabilities that enable AI application delivery across Google Cloud Platform, Kubernetes, Terraform, and CI/CD ecosystems. You'll partner closely with Cloud Engineering, Platform Architecture, Security, and Product teams to drive developer productivity, platform reliability, and operational excellence. If you're looking for an opportunity to make a significant impact on enterprise AI infrastructure, join us at GXO.
Pay, benefits and more
We are eager to attract the best, so we offer competitive compensation and a generous benefits package, including full health insurance (medical, dental and vision), 401(k), life insurance, disability and the opportunity to participate in a company incentive plan.
What you'll do on a typical day
  • Establish the enterprise DevOps operating model for GXO's Agentic AI Platform, including CI/CD standards, branching strategies, release governance, environment promotion, deployment approvals, and operational handoff practices.
  • Design, build, and manage secure, repeatable CI/CD pipelines supporting AI platform infrastructure, platform services, agents, MCP servers, LiteLLM, Agent Gateway integrations, model-serving components, and supporting services.
  • Engineer, deploy, and operate Kubernetes-based platform capabilities on Google Kubernetes Engine (GKE), including deployment standards, Helm or Kustomize, autoscaling, network policies, workload identity, secrets management, ingress/egress, observability, and production runbooks.
  • Own Terraform infrastructure delivery by developing reusable modules, managing state, enforcing pull request controls, implementing policy guardrails, maintaining environment parity, detecting configuration drift, and promoting infrastructure across development, test, staging, and production environments.
  • Partner with the Principal Cloud Engineer to implement Google Cloud Platform foundations while leading day-to-day DevOps enablement, release engineering, Kubernetes operations, pipeline reliability, and developer experience.
  • Collaborate with the Principal Cloud AI Platform Architect to translate enterprise architecture standards, reference architectures, and architectural decision records (ADRs) into automated build, test, deployment, and operational processes.
  • Enable Phase 2 platform capabilities, including GKE-based open-source model serving, vLLM or comparable inference runtimes, scalable deployment patterns, model tiering infrastructure, and cost-governed platform operations.
  • Implement enterprise DevSecOps controls in partnership with Information Security, including vulnerability scanning, dependency scanning, container image hardening, Binary Authorization (or equivalent), secrets management, audit logging, and secure deployment gates.
  • Create standardized "paved road" developer workflows that enable engineers to provision environments, deploy AI agents, publish MCP services, test integrations, and promote code changes through approved automation.
  • Champion AI-assisted software engineering practices by enabling secure AI coding tools, automated testing, documentation generation, code review acceleration, pipeline diagnostics, and developer productivity improvements.
  • Build comprehensive observability across the platform through logs, metrics, traces, dashboards, alerts, SLOs, SLIs, deployment health monitoring, traceability, cost attribution, and operational readiness reporting.
  • Automate operational processes to reduce manual effort, improve incident response readiness, and maintain runbooks for releases, rollbacks, break-glass procedures, platform operations, and escalation processes.
  • Support secure integration between the AI platform and Snowflake-governed data access patterns through automated deployment, configuration, policy enforcement, and runtime observability.
  • Develop and maintain engineering documentation, including CI/CD standards, Terraform module guidance, Kubernetes operating procedures, release checklists, onboarding documentation, and operational runbooks.

About GXO Logistics

Sourced by ZipRecruiter

GXO Logistics, located in Greenwich, CT, US, is a global leader in the logistics industry. Specializing in innovative supply chain management, it operates across various sectors including e-commerce, food and beverage, technology, and retail. The company has cemented a notable reputation for providing top-notch outsourcing solutions that equip businesses to respond to market changes quickly and efficiently. Originally part of XPO Logistics, GXO, officially separated and spun off as a unique corporation in 2021, taking with it decades of expertise and a robust client roster. Their mission is to propel businesses forward with cutting-edge logistics and transportation solutions while adhering to their core values of safety always, customer-centric, and inclusive.
